For a 6kW solar system, a battery capacity of 10-14 kWh is typically sufficient to maximize self-consumption and minimize reliance on the grid. However, the exact number of batteries will depend on your usage and desired backup time. [pdf]

A 300 watt solar panel produces approximately 1,200 kilowatt hours (kWh) of electricity per year.2 The average home in the United States uses approximately 9,000 kWh of electricity per year.3 This means that a 300 watt solar panel can offset approximately 13% of the electricity used in an average home. A 1.5kW system using 370W panels will require about 7.0 square meters of roof to be installed. Each 370W panel measures about 1.75m x 1m. 1.5kW solar power systems are mostly suitable for single occupant. This size of solar power system is classed as "Residential". [pdf]
